The garage occupancy feed for the Brindlewood campus arrives over a message queue every thirty seconds, one record per level, published by the Stallgrid edge boxes. Counts can briefly go negative when a sensor double-fires on exit; the ingest job clamps these to zero and flags the interval. If the feed stalls for more than five minutes, the dashboard falls back to the last known snapshot. Sensor mappings, queue names, and the replay procedure are documented on the internal page below.

runbook for tahog-kadug: https://gitlab.qirvanworks.corp/projects/pages/view/b139298aed28

Lift maintenance at Farrowgate Tower runs Saturdays, 07:00–13:00. Contractors from Kelden Vertical should use the goods entrance on Millbrook Lane and sign in with the duty porter. Service keys are issued on site and returned before leaving. To reach the motor room on Level 12, enter the keypad code below.

staff pass of kawip-hawef = bdg-QLP-2

## ALERT: ProfileStore Resharding in Progress

The Kestrelbay user-profile store is being split from 4 to 16 shards. During migration windows, plugin reads via the Profile API may return stale data for up to 90 seconds, and writes to migrating shards will return HTTP 503 with a `retry-after` header. Honor the header; do not implement custom retry loops. Schedule and shard map updates are posted hourly. Questions go to the address below.

escalation mailbox, hadug-bajog: sormir@norvalabs.internal

TURN-208: Gatevale turnstile counters at the Merrow Field pilot double-count when a rotation reverses mid-cycle. Attendance totals drift roughly 2% high per event. The debounce window fix is implemented, reviewed by Ilsa, and soak-tested across two simulated match days without drift. Ready for your cut; the candidate build is identified below.

trace token, tagag-tafog: htk6_5ed18c

Hey Mira, welcome to the on-call rotation! Quick heads-up before you review anything touching ReportForge: the builder's column sort is NOT stable by default. If two rows tie on the sort key, their order can flip between renders, which is why the Quarterly Ops export keeps "shuffling." Dena patched the grid layer to use a stable merge sort, but a few legacy templates still call the old comparator. Flag those in review. The full list of affected templates lives on the internal wiki page here.

runbook for badug-kadup: https://confluence.zemvarlabs.internal/projects/browse/display/projects/bd1b